New chapter for Plymouth hotelA major Plymouth hotel is set for a new chapter in its history after a deal has been agreed to sell it to new owners.
Legacy Hotels and Resorts manage and represent 24 hotels across the UK, Jersey and Southern Spain and are embarking on an expansion programme in the South West. Chief Executive Andy Townsend said: “The 100-bedroom hotel fits our profile for hotels and is a well positioned foothold in the South West. “We have a number of pipeline projects that will have us becoming a better established name in the region. “It is a three star hotel which is very well located with good links to the A38 and we believe that we can make several key improvements to help drive trade forward. “The existing staff will be transferring across to work for the hotel, but the current general manager will stay with Accor, which owns the Novotel brand.” NOTES TO EDITORS Legacy Hotels and Resorts operates and manages an eclectic range of four and three-star properties ranging in style from country houses to city centre establishments across the UK, Jersey and Spain.
